Analysis of What is your favourite colour!



"You are a liar, I hate you! You worthless piece of shit" she screams.
Failing to understand the concept of 'there's more to this than meets the eye' and everything she said a stranger would definitely deny...
.
.
I realize oh my veins appear purple and purple is a colour of forgiveness...
So I forgive!  
.
.
I know her heart bleeds more than it beats,
and her favorite colour is black,
but black is the colour of grief,
maybe grief is all she knows...
So I forgive!  
.
.
In anxiety she bites her lips,
sometimes a little hard; it bleeds,
Oh dear lord I thought red was love,
but she bleeds and it tastes like anguish...
So I forgive!
.
.
Staring at a reflection that I usually hate more often than I love...
I look at those chestnut brown eyes
that seem crying for help...
So I forgive!
.
.
And deep down I be(lie)ve,
everything she said a stranger would deny... Maybe!

Hello! *waving a hand in front of my eyes* you seem lost he said.
"I'm sorry! I zoned out, what was your question again?"
"No problem! Your favourite colour" he smiled.
"Well.... Black, brown, red and shades of purple it is!" I lied
